About:
On February 14th, Sayville High School embraced the spirit of kindness and positivity by celebrating P.S. I Love You Day, a day dedicated to spreading love, support, and mental health awareness. The day was marked by a series of uplifting activities, organized by the students and clubs of the school, including SADD, Anchor Club, Student Government, Peer Leaders, and more.
A Day of Kindness and Positivity
Throughout the day, students and staff worked together to create an atmosphere filled with love and positivity. One of the standout activities was the distribution of purple Hershey’s Kisses, a simple yet sweet gesture that encouraged everyone to share kindness. The color purple became a symbol of support for mental health awareness, and the school community came together to wear purple, showing solidarity in promoting positive mental health.
Another highlight was the creation of the Kindness Wall, where students and staff wrote messages of encouragement and support. This wall quickly became a vibrant display of love, with heartfelt notes that inspired everyone who walked past. The wall served as a reminder of the power of kind words and the importance of lifting each other up.
Mindfulness Activities and Support Stations
In addition to the Kindness Wall, the event featured a range of activities to promote mindfulness and emotional well-being. There was a ‘Take What You Need’ post-it station, where students could grab a positive affirmation or message to carry with them throughout the day. The thoughtful messages provided a moment of calm and reassurance for anyone who needed it.
The music played throughout the school also helped set the tone for the day, with uplifting tunes that encouraged joy and unity. Students had the chance to participate in various mindfulness activities to help reduce stress and promote emotional health, making the event not only fun but also beneficial for mental well-being.
